Finding a suitable name for my makeup business
I just recently decided to start a makeup/makeover business, where I render my services to brides, models, or people that just want a makeover. I already have a name I want to use but I don't want to put 'makeover' behind it ex. Kim's Makeover. Because it seems like every other makeover businness has that word behind their name. Is there something else that's creative that I could use? Because obviously the name can't stand alone. Thank you

Some other words that come to mind -
Personal Image Consultant
Cosmetic Application
Glamour Service
Or don't have the type of service in the name. For example, there's a service profiled on a television series called "Glam Fairy" You can't steal that name of course, but it doesn't really say exactly she does.
I would do something like,
New You Personal Style (or whatever you name your business)
- Make-up consulting and application
- Hair styling
- Personal Shopping and clothing consultation
Available for:
Weddings, bachelorette parties, proms or just call for a new every-day look!

You could play with the word 'transform' or 'transformation.' Maybe that could be the name all by itself, with a subtitle, 'a new you, by Claire.' I like the name Claire, which means clear in French, and sounds good for skin, eyes, a fresh look.
I wouldn't use a first name in the title, and not as a possessive.
Paul Mitchell sounds so much better than Paul's Hair Products.
Sounds too much like Joe's Used Cars down on the corner.
